Comparison between Xiaomi Mi Notebook Air 13.3-inch & 12.5-inch variants

Xiaomi finally has a laptop in its portfolio. The Xiaomi Mi Notebook Air is the new laptop in the market and it runs Windows 10 OS, thankfully, the standard one that hasn’t been played with and the user is going to see only the external difference when comparing with any other laptops in the market.

The Mi Notebook Air is launched with two variants, which differ not just with the screen size but also with the internal specs. Let’s check out how do both the laptops differ with specs because except the size difference, you won’t notice anything else different externally.

Xiaomi Mi Notebook Air variants

Similarities between the 13.3-inch & 12.5-inch Mi Notebook Air

  • Both the laptops have a metal body, backlit keyboard
  • USB Type-C port for charging, quick charging support is seen on both
  • Both the Airs have 802.11ac dual-band Wi-Fi connectivity
  • Both the laptops have a Full HD, fully laminated display with glass protection
  • AKG custom grade dual speakers support Dolby Digital surround sound
  • Supports Bluetooth 4.1 and can be unlocked with Mi Band 2
  • Windows 10 home is the OS these laptops are running
  • Both the laptops are Mi Cloud Sync ready

Differences between the 13.3-inch & 12.5-inch Mi Notebook Air

Processor, RAM, and Storage

  • The 13.3-inch variant has the Intel Core i5 processor, NVIDIA GeForce 940MX high-performance dedicated graphics card, and 8GB DDR4 RAM. The storage included in the laptop is expandable 256GB PCIe SSD storage.
  • The 12.5-inch variant has the Intel Core M3 processor and 4GB of RAM. There is an expandable 128GB SATA SSD storage included.

Thickness and Weight

  • The 13.3-inch variant of the Mi Notebook Air is 14.8mm in thickness, while the 12.5-inch one is 12.9mm thick.
  • The bigger variant is 1.28kg while the smaller one is 1.07kg.

Battery life

The 13.3-inch Mi Notebook Air is said to have a battery life of 9.5 hours while the 12.5-inch Mi Notebook Air comes with a battery life of 11.5 hours on regular usage.

Pricing

The Notebook Air is priced at RMB 3499 for the smaller, i.e. 12.5-inch variant while the 13.3-inch larger variant is priced at RMB 4999.
